What are two characteristics of partial copy sandboxes versus full sandboxes? choose 2 answers
Minchanka [31]

-A Full Sandbox can only be refreshed every 29 days, whereas a Partial Copy Sandbox can be refreshed every 5 days.

-Only sample data is copied to a Partial Copy Sandbox on creation/refresh, whereas all data is copied over to a Full Sandbox .

Full Sandbox

A Full sandbox is intended to be used as a testing environment. Only Full sandboxes support performance testing, load testing, and staging. Full sandboxes are a replica of your production org, including all data, such as object records and attachments, and metadata. The length of the refresh interval makes it difficult to use Full sandboxes for development.
